UI/UX Designer Salary in Cameroon
Mid‑level UI/UX designers in Cameroon earn about Fr307,500 XAF per year. Douala and Yaoundé are mentioned as locations with demand. Employers such as telecom firms, fintech startups, and NGOs seek intuitive digital experiences.
Salary by experience level
Entry-level (0-2 years)
Salary range (per year)
Fr180,000 to Fr255,000
Average (per year)
Fr210,000
Public sector projects and small enterprises in Mayo-Banyo hire entry-level UI/UX designers.
Mid-level (3-5 years)
Salary range (per year)
Fr260,000 to Fr360,000
Average (per year)
Fr307,500
Regional telecoms and digital service providers employ mid-level designers, reflecting increased experience.
Senior (6-9 years)
Salary range (per year)
Fr355,000 to Fr495,000
Average (per year)
Fr425,000
Senior designers support government IT projects or manage teams.
Principal/Lead (10+ years)
Salary range (per year)
Fr500,000+

Market Overview
Local companies work on mobile banking and e‑learning platforms, resulting in UI/UX openings. Prototyping skills and knowledge of French and English interfaces are valued. Salaries vary across regions with different living costs.
